The decoded crash log below is the preserved=0D unfixed reference panic from an earlier 7.1.0-rc1 run.=0D =0D This series contains one patch:=0D 1/1 ipv6: ip6mr: fix mr_table lifetime leak=0D =0D We provide bug details, reproducer steps, and a crash log below.=0D =0D ---- details below ----=0D =0D Bug details:=0D =0D MRT6_TABLE should only select a multicast routing table, but a fresh=0D non-default mr_table could still outlive the socket once MRT6_INIT=0D published it. After MRT6_DONE or socket close, ip6mr_sk_done() cleared=0D the routing state but left an empty table linked from mr6_tables, so=0D repeated MRT6_TABLE(fresh id) -> MRT6_INIT -> MRT6_DONE/close cycles=0D accumulated detached tables until netns teardown and eventually=0D exhausted memory.=0D =0D A safe fix needs to account for RCU readers in lookup, getsockopt,=0D ioctl, and multicast data paths. This series keeps MRT6_TABLE as a=0D pure selector, adds refcounted lifetime pins for runtime users and=0D socket ownership, removes empty non-default tables from the published=0D set with list_del_rcu() during teardown, and defers the final free to=0D process context when the last reference drops outside RTNL. The common=0D mr_table allocator also holds a netns reference until final table=0D destruction.=0D =0D Reproducer:=0D =0D host$ qemu-img create -f qcow2 -F raw \=0D -b /mnt/d/WSL/prepare-package/kernel-image/bullseye.img \=0D /tmp/ip6mr-master-verify-overlay.qcow2=0D host$ qemu-system-x86_64 -m 2G -cpu host -smp 2 \=0D -machine accel=3Dkvm \=0D -kernel /var/cache/linux-patch/ip6mr-master-build/arch/x86/boot/bzIma= ge \=0D -append 'root=3D/dev/sda rw console=3DttyS0 earlyprintk=3Dserial \=0D net.ifnames=3D0 biosdevname=3D0 panic_on_warn=3D1 oops=3Dpanic \=0D slub_debug=3DFZPU page_poison=3D1 init_on_alloc=3D1 init_on_free=3D1'= \=0D -drive file=3D/tmp/ip6mr-master-verify-overlay.qcow2,format=3Dqcow2 \= =0D -nographic -netdev user,id=3Dnet0,hostfwd=3Dtcp::19023-:22 \=0D -device virtio-net-pci,netdev=3Dnet0=0D host$ scp -P 19023 poc.static verify-clean/poc-initdone.static \=0D root@localhost:/tmp/=0D guest# /tmp/poc.static 30000 1=0D guest# /tmp/poc-initdone.static 10000 500000 close=0D guest# /tmp/poc-initdone.static 10000 600000 done=0D guest# su - test_user -c \=0D 'unshare -Urn sh -c "/tmp/poc-initdone.static \=0D 10000 700000 done"'=0D =0D We run the PoC in a 2 vCPU, 2 GB RAM x86 QEMU environment.=0D =0D The main INIT/close and INIT/DONE reproducer is shown first.
